Special Events Remembrance Service to mark the 70th Anniversary of the Dodecanese Campaign Sunday 8th September 2013 at the National Memorial Arboretum, Croxall Road, Alrewas, Staffordshire, DE13 7AR Veterans, families and friends of service personnel will gather at the National Memorial Arboretum to attend a short service at 12.30 in the Millennium Chapel followed by the dedication of a bench near the Brotherhood of Greek Veterans' Chapel Memorial in remembrance of all those who gave their lives at sea, in the air and on Leros, Kos and other islands.
